Our client is looking for a Paralegal - Guardianship to support their legal team in managing sensitive and detail-oriented guardianship cases. They operate within the legal services industry and have strengthened their presence in recent years by expanding client-focused services and refining internal processes to deliver consistent, high-quality outcomes. This role is ideal for someone who is highly organized, confident in client communication, and experienced in drafting legal documentation. The selected candidate will play a key role in coordinating case information, ensuring accurate filings, and supporting attorneys throughout guardianship proceedings. A strong understanding or exposure to guardianship processes is essential, as this position requires handling cases involving vulnerable individuals and close interaction with families and stakeholders. Responsibilities Prepare, review, and draft a variety of legal documents related to guardianship cases Organize, maintain, and update case files with accuracy and consistency Manage deadlines by tracking schedules and proactively reminding attorneys of key dates Perform legal research to support case preparation and filings File legal documents electronically in accordance with court requirements Communicate directly with clients to request documentation, provide updates, and explain case progress Coordinate with clients’ family members, referral partners, and external vendors when needed Facilitate document execution processes, including client meetings when required Use legal management and accounting systems to track time, expenses, and case activity Requirements Prior experience as a Paralegal, Legal Assistant, or Legal Secretary Hands-on experience supporting guardianship cases or similar legal processes Strong written and verbal communication skills for client-facing interactions Ability to manage multiple cases while maintaining strong attention to detail Comfortable working with sensitive information and maintaining confidentiality Familiarity with court procedures, ideally across multiple jurisdictions (Florida experience is a plus) Qualifications Bachelor’s degree or Paralegal certification Advanced proficiency in Microsoft Word and Adobe Strong working knowledge of Microsoft Excel Experience with legal practice management software is highly preferred Benefits Full-time position 100% remote work environment Opportunity to work closely with a collaborative legal team Exposure to specialized guardianship cases and processes Stable, long-term role with growth potential
